How NORWOOD CROSSING Compares

NORWOOD CROSSING is a 131-bed nonprofit nursing facility in Chicago, Illinois. It holds an overall CMS rating of 3 out of 5 stars, above the Illinois average of 2.6 stars. Its strongest area is staffing, rated 4 stars. Its rate of high-risk residents with pressure ulcers (7.2%) is above the Illinois average of 5.0% — a measure worth asking the staff about. With 131 certified beds, it maintains moderate occupancy at roughly 79% occupied.

Among the 77 nursing facilities ElderVoice tracks in Chicago, 6 hold a 5-star rating and the local average is 2.1 stars.

By the numbers vs. Illinois average

  • Long-stay antipsychotic medication use: 26.3% — worse than the Illinois average of 21.8%.
  • Falls with major injury: 2.7% — better than the Illinois average of 3.1%.
  • High-risk pressure ulcers: 7.2% — worse than the Illinois average of 5.0% (43% higher).
  • Short-stay rehospitalization: 22.0% — better than the Illinois average of 26.1%.

Comparisons use CMS Care Compare data (updated May 4, 2026) measured against Illinois averages across 667 facilities tracked by ElderVoice.

The Senior Community Around Chicago

Chicago sits in Cook County, where adults 65 and older make up about 14.7% of the population — a share of seniors in line with Illinois as a whole (15.7% statewide). The area's median household income is consistent with state averages.
